Terrazzo tile repair services involve restoring the appearance and integrity of terrazzo flooring, which is made from a composite of marble, quartz, granite, or glass chips embedded in a cement or epoxy binder. Over time, terrazzo surfaces can develop cracks, chips, or stains due to regular wear, heavy impacts, or moisture infiltration. Skilled service providers can assess the damage and perform repairs that may include filling cracks, replacing broken sections, or refinishing the surface to match the original look. Proper repair work helps maintain the durability and aesthetic appeal of terrazzo floors, extending their lifespan and preventing further deterioration.
Many common problems that terrazzo repair services address include surface cracks that can deepen and cause further damage if left untreated, as well as chips or missing pieces that mar the floor’s appearance. Stains or discoloration from spills or foot traffic can also diminish the visual appeal of terrazzo surfaces. In addition, terrazzo that has become uneven or loose may pose safety concerns. Professional repair services can resolve these issues effectively, restoring the floor’s smoothness, strength, and visual consistency, which is especially important in high-traffic areas or spaces where appearance matters.

The overview below groups typical Terrazzo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Livonia,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or terrazzo tile repairs in Livonia, MI range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as chip or crack repairs, f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and tile size.
Moderate Restoration - Mid-sized projects like resurfacing or patching larger areas us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These are common for homes and businesses seeking to restore the appearance of their terrazzo floors.
Full Floor Resurfacing - Complete resurfacing or refinishing of terrazzo floors can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Many projects in this range involve multiple rooms or extensive surface preparation.
Full Replacement - Replacing entire terrazzo floors, especially in larger or more complex spaces, can cost $4,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push into higher cost tiers, but are less common than mid-range rep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
